- What are the benefits of being active?
-
Regular physical activity can benefit your heart, weight,
muscles and mind. Physical activity can help protect you from
developing health problems, or assist you to manage and control
existing medical conditions.

- Are there any walking groups in Newham?
-
Yes, the Newham Striders and Rambles walk group is an urban
walking scheme offering seven walks per week plus four walks per
week for adults with learning difficulties and monthly countryside
rambles. (The walks take place in and around Newham with the
majority in local parks). The Saturday walk is aimed at the more
experienced walkers or for those who want to progress to a longer

The Health Walks are a purposeful, structured walk programme
designed to suit all abilities for the purpose of improving an
individual's health and wellbeing. The programme is delivered in
local parks across the borough. Referral is by your GP, practice
nurse or health professional for the scheme. If you would like to

- What are Trim Trails?
-
Trim trails are walking and jogging routes around parks, lined
with a great range of outdoor gym equipment. The equipment is free
to use for those over 14s, whether you're a fitness fanatic or just
fancy burning off those extra calories. There are 4 Trim Trails in
Newham:- (1) Brampton Park Recreation Ground E6 (2) Canning Town
Recreation Ground E16 (3) Forest Lane Park E7 (4) Keir Hardie
Recreation Ground E16
